Studies on Work Hours and Productivity

When I first examined the data, the pattern was unmistakable: exceeding a 40-hour workweek slices per-hour output by roughly 12%. The math is simple - extra hours mean diminishing marginal returns, as workers fatigue and focus wanes. This isn’t a new discovery; economists have long noted that labor productivity peaks before the 40-hour mark (Wikipedia). Yet the modern workplace, awash with digital tools, still clings to the myth that longer hours equal greater results.

Cross-industry reports now tell a different story. Firms that introduced flexible time blocks - allowing employees to batch deep work during their peak cognitive windows - registered a 9% boost in overall labor productivity over six months. The metric used was output per worker, a direct measure of how much value each employee added when given autonomy over their schedule. This aligns with a 2024 MIT study that linked flexible scheduling to higher engagement scores.

Legacy productivity metrics from the 20th century, built for assembly lines, ignore the collaborative gains of digital platforms. New indicators capture a 15% climb in task completion speed when teams leverage real-time cloud tools. I saw this firsthand while consulting for a mid-size software firm; after shifting to a results-only work environment, they shaved weeks off project timelines without hiring extra staff.

"Flexible scheduling can lift labor productivity by up to 15% when digital collaboration is fully embraced," notes a recent PRSA workplace trends report.

These findings compel leaders to rethink the old "nine-to-five" dogma. Instead of policing clock-in times, the focus should shift to outcomes, energy cycles, and the quality of output per hour.

Study Work From Home Productivity

A national survey of 16,000 Australians revealed that women with flexible home-office arrangements reported a 23% boost in perceived mental wellbeing. That psychological lift correlated with a modest 5% productivity gain - a reminder that wellbeing and output are two sides of the same coin. The study, tracked by Australian researchers, underscores how flexibility can be a lever for both health and performance.

Organizations that introduced discretionary remote days cut absenteeism by 11% while nudging task completion rates up 8%. The data suggests that when employees control when they work, they schedule their most demanding tasks during personal peak periods, reducing the need for sick days.

However, remote work isn’t a free pass. Cognitive costs arise when boundaries blur. Companies that instituted clear after-hours communication policies saw a 6% rise in focus scores. Employees reported fewer interruptions and better ability to segment work from personal time, a critical factor for sustained productivity.

From my consulting days, I observed that teams that codified “no-meeting blocks” and respected them saw fewer errors and higher creativity. The takeaway is simple: remote work thrives on intentional structure, not laissez-faire chaos.

Impact of Remote Work on Employee Motivation

Hybrid teams - those split between remote and in-office settings - registered an 11% increase in task accountability scores. The blend creates a sense of shared responsibility; remote members know they’re visible through deliverables, while in-office peers benefit from spontaneous collaboration.

Conversely, micromanagement in remote contexts drags motivational metrics down by 6%. When leaders hover over screens, they erode trust, prompting disengagement. Autonomy-driven environments, however, can lift productivity by up to 9%, reinforcing the argument that freedom fuels output.

Result-oriented remote models also boost morale by 12%, which correlates with a 5% rise in innovation metrics. Employees who are judged on outcomes, not hours, invest creative energy into problem-solving rather than clock-watching.

My own observation aligns: teams that set clear OKRs (Objectives and Key Results) and let members choose their work rhythms consistently outperformed more controlled groups. The data underscores that motivation is a function of trust, clarity, and autonomy.


Office Attendance and Productivity Metrics

Statistical analysis shows that high daily office attendance correlates with a 4% dip in per-worker productivity. The law of diminishing returns applies; beyond a certain density, collaboration becomes interference, and focus suffers.

Companies that embraced flexible core hours cut customer-service delays by 14% while maintaining - or even increasing - output levels. By allowing staff to align work windows with peak demand periods, they reduced bottlenecks and improved response times.

Embedding hybrid event schedules - alternating virtual and in-person meetings - reduced meeting fatigue, yielding a 7% climb in effective task completion within the first quarter of rollout. Employees reported clearer agendas and shorter meeting lengths, freeing time for deep work.

From a practical standpoint, I advise leaders to track attendance not as a compliance metric but as a leading indicator of collaboration health. When attendance spikes without a corresponding rise in output, it signals a need to redesign processes, not to enforce stricter presence rules.
